parid (PAH-rid) - n., any of numerous small passerine birds of the family Paridae, the tits and chickadees.


No relationship to marid, sorry. The difference between a tit and a chickadee is that if it lives the Old World, it's a tit, and if it lives in the New World, it's a chickadee (unless it's a titmouse). Name is, via the family name, from Latin parus, tit (and by extension chickadee).
